BMW R 1200GS Adventure (2011)
The 2011 BMW R 1200GS Adventure motorcycle has a horizontally opposed Boxer engine with a capacity of 1170 cc, providing 110 hp and 120 Nm of torque. It features a six-speed transmission with a shaft drive and a tubular steel frame. The front suspension is Telelever with a stanchion of 41 mm and a central spring strut, while the rear suspension is a die-cast aluminum single-sided swinging arm with BMW Motorrad Paralever. The front brakes consist of two 305mm discs with a four-piston caliper, and the rear brake is a single 265mm disc with a two-piston caliper. The motorcycle has a 33L fuel capacity and weighs 223kg dry or 256kg wet (fully fueled). Its consumption average is 6.3L/100km, and it has a top speed of 193km/h.
Technical specifications:
Make Model: BMW R 1200GS Adventure
Year: 2011
Engine: Four stroke, two cylinder horizontally opposed Boxer, DOHC, 4 valves per cylinder
Capacity: 1170 cc / 71.4 cub in.
Bore x Stroke: 101 x 73 mm
Compression Ratio: 12.0:1
Cooling System: Air/oil cooled
Induction: BMS-K+, 50mm Throttle butterfly dia
Ignition: BMS-K
Starting: Electric
Electrical System: Alternator three-phase alternator 720 W Battery 12 V / 14 Ah, maintenance-free
Clutch: Single-plate dry clutch, 180mm
Exhaust management: Fully-controlled three-way catalytic converter
Max Power: 81 kW / 110 hp @ 7750 rpm
Max Torque: 120 Nm / 12.2 kgf-m / 88 lb-ft @ 6000 rpm
Transmission: 6 Speed
Drive: Shaft
Gear Ratios: 1st 2.375 / 2nd 1.696 / 3rd 1.296 / 4th 0.065 / 5th 0.939 / 6th 0.848:1
Frame: Tubular steel frame, load-bearing power unit
Front Suspension: Telelever, stanchion 41mm, central spring strut, spring preload 9 times mechanically adjustable.
Front Wheel Travel: 210 mm / 8.3 in.
Rear Suspension: Die-cast aluminium single-sided swinging arm with BMW Motorrad Paralever, WAD strut (travel-related damping), spring pre-load hydraulically adjustable to continuously variable levels by means of handwheel, rebound damping adjustable.
Rear Wheel Travel: 220 mm / 8.7 in.
Front Brakes: 2 x 305mm Discs, 4 piston caliper, Optional: BMW Motorrad Integral ABS
Rear Brakes: Single 265mm disc, 2 piston caliper, Optional: BMW Motorrad Integral ABS
Front Tyre: 110/80 ZR19
Rear Tyre: 150/70 ZR17
Rim, Front: 2.50 x 19″
Rim, rear: 4.00 x 17″
Wheelbase: 1507 mm / 59.3 in
Rake: 25.7 degrees
Castor: 101 mm / 3.97 in.
Dimensions: Length: 2210 mm / 87.0 in. Width: 915 mm / 36.0 in. Height: 1450 mm / 57.1 in.
Seat Height: 890 – 910 mm / 35.0 – 35.8 in.
Dry Weight: 223 kg / 492 lbs
Wet-Weight: 256 kg / 564 lbs (road ready, fully fueled )
Fuel Capacity: 33 L / 8.7 US gal
Reserve Tank: 4L / 1.1 US gal
Consumption Average: 6.3 L/100 km / 15.7 km/l / 36.9 US mpg
Standing 1/4 Mile: 12.6 sec
Top Speed: 193 km/h / 120 mph
